#8962bc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8962bc is composed of 53.7% red, 38.4%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.1% cyan, 47.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 266 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 56.1%. #8962b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#130079.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#8962bc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8962bc has RGB values of R:137, G:98,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 9003708.

Hex triplet 8962bc #8962bc
RGB Decimal 137, 98, 188 rgb(137,98,188)
RGB Percent 53.7, 38.4, 73.7 rgb(53.7%,38.4%,73.7%)
CMYK 27, 48, 0, 26
HSL 266°, 40.2, 56.1 hsl(266,40.2%,56.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 266°, 47.9, 73.7
Web Safe 9966cc #9966cc
CIE-LAB 49.111, 34.319, -41.767
XYZ 23.76, 17.685, 49.736
xyY 0.261, 0.194, 17.685
CIE-LCH 49.111, 54.058, 309.409
CIE-LUV 49.111, 12.148, -67.132
Hunter-Lab 42.053, 27.258, -40.684
Binary 10001001, 01100010, 10111100

Shades and Tints of #8962bc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050308 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8962bc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8d91 is the less saturated color, while #8126f8 is the most saturated one.
